ICRC to provide food aid to 9700 displaced families in Marib

MARIB-SABA
Deputy Governor of Marib Abd-Rabbu Miftah discussed Monday with the Deputy Head of the International Committee of the Red Cross and Mission in Yemen Friya Radhi preparations for humanitarian interventions for providing food aid to 9700 displaced families here via the Yemeni Red Crescent late of this February.

Miftah praised humanitarian efforts made by the organization for supporting projects help alleviating suffering of the displaced people, confirming keenness of the authority on providing necessary facilitations to ICRC for carrying out its projects.

He pointed out to big numbers of displaced people received by Marib over Houthi militia's war on Yemen and imposed challenges on the local authority to provide basic services to hosting community and the displaced people.

For her part, Radhi made it clear that the committee's team will evaluate the humanitarian situation of the displaced people and their needs for making inclusive vision on program interventions in fields of food, shelter, medications, water and sanitation.
